Q3 Planning Note — Board of Veldane Logistics

Negotiations on the Harwick Quay depot lease resume next month. Landlord Corbelstone Estates has signalled openness to a five-year term with a capped escalator, contingent on us absorbing minor maintenance. Finance has modelled both exit and renewal scenarios; renewal remains favourable under most assumptions. The strategic context for the board is summarised below.

internal memo for bahap-yagug: Headcount on the Ulaix team goes from 3 to 100 by the end of January. Gross margin on Ulaix came in at 10 percent against a plan of 15 percent.

Release checklist — PickWeave optimizer: confirm the bin-affinity heuristic flag defaults to off, rerun the Tallow Creek warehouse regression suite, and diff pick-path lengths against last release (tolerance 2%). If the solver seed changed, note it in the changelog. Do not ship without re-signing the route bundle. Record the build token from the signing step below this entry.

session token of tajef-bageg = htk21_5d90d574934f3ccae6437

Nice work on `pixsquish batch` — the worker pool is way cleaner than the old fork-per-file mess. One ask for future maintainers: don't bury the concurrency and memory caps inside the resize loop. Pull them up top as named constants so we can tune for the Greymarsh render boxes without spelunking. Here's the set I'd start with.

constants for bawif-kawif:
QUOTAS = {
    "ulaael": 5,
    "holael": 10,
}

**Handover: Cold storage archival — from Priya's rotation to Tomas**

For the weekly sync: the Glacierloft archival job has migrated 14 of 22 cold storage buckets. Remaining buckets are mid-verification, so do not trigger manual archival runs until checksums finish, roughly Wednesday. Lifecycle policies are already applied; the dashboard shows per-bucket progress. If the archival worker stalls and needs its state store unsealed, unlock it with the recovery passphrase below.

recovery phrase for kahog-fajeg: juleth-gilael-ralax-gorvan-norax-aldeth

It owns snapshot persistence, redo-branch pruning, and the encrypted autosave journal. Changes to serialization formats, retention windows, or journal encryption require review by this subsystem's owner before merge; no other team may modify these paths. Escalations about suspected history tampering should also be routed here. The accountable owner of this subsystem is named below.

signatory, yagap-bawig: Ulaath Eliath